Decentralization is the most essential feature of blockchain, which achieves self-verification, transmission, and management of information, without relying on additional third-party management institutions or hardware facilities. Openness makes the blockchain technology infrastructure open-source, except for the private information of the parties involved in the transaction, which is encrypted. The data is open to everyone else, enhancing the system's transparency. Independence is manifested in the consensus-based norms and protocols, where the entire blockchain system does not depend on other third parties. Security ensures that as long as it is impossible to  control more than 51% of the data nodes, it is impossible to arbitrarily manipulate and modify the network data. Anonymity allows users to maintain privacy while participating in the network."}]}],"pr":"a4e76791a93b619706f718624292e07de088d95ff7dbeab3d599a6648787c31e"}
